I am seeing a higher than normal number of tickets closed as Cannot Reproduce. 
I think this is partially due to the nature of the release.
At the same time, a decent number of those JIRAs are being reopened because 
they keep cropping up on the QA environments.

Before closing a ticket as Cannot Reproduce, can you make sure to re-test on 
the environment on which it was reported in additional to local builds? If you 
need assistance in reproducing a bug or testing a fix, I'm happy to help.

We have seen at least one bug in the past (I don't recall the JIRA at the 
moment) that did not manifest on local builds. However, it manifested reliably 
on the QA servers and was a bug that needed to be fixed. 

I've brought qa22 up to the current code base as well. We can use that to 
verify bugs on a second environment (beyond local builds). Bert and I have also 
used it to verify fixes by deploying jars directly to it. Please coordinate 
that kind of testing with me as we don't want to bump into each other.
